Four more succumb to coronavirus in Banke



NEPALGUNJ: Four more persons have succumbed to coronavirus in Banke district.

All the four deceased are from outside the district.

Tej Bahadur Wali, focal person of District COVID-19 Crisis Management Center, Banke, said four people from Bardiya, Salyan, and Dang died last night and today morning.

A 42-year-old woman of Dang Tulsipur Sub-Metropolitan- 4 undergoing treatment at Kohalpur Medical College died last night.

Likewise, a 42-year-old man of Bansgadhi Municipality-3 of Bardiya died at Bheri Hospital early Sunday morning.

Similarly, a 61-year-old man of Salyan Bagchaur Municipality-8 died at Bheri Hospital early Sunday morning.

Likewise, a 58-year-old woman of Bardiya Badhayatal-5 has died at the Bheri Hospital on Sunday morning, according to Wali.
